Reporting bugs and submitting patches
We use bugzilla.gnome.org for bug tracking. Patches should be attached to a bug in git format-patch
format.
Source code
Reinteract development is managed using git. For information about checking out the code from the master repository, see the Download Page
The following links can help you get started using git.
- The git web site has lots of documentation and links, including the official git tutorial.
- Git Tips from the GNOME Website. See in particular the section on git-bz, which is a convenient tool for using Git to submit patches to bugzilla.
- If you want to publish your own Reinteract Git repository, github can be a convenient place to do that.
